Tag: TKEY (InitialKey)
For classical music I (often) tag the (initial) key the work is written in. For mp3-files I use the tag-name TKEY (as the standard defines, http://id3.org/d3v2.3.0). For flac-files I use INITIALKEY. (Actually I simply use mp3tag: %initialkey%, and those are the tag-names I end up with. But to me it seems, that's what the mp3-tagging standard provides for, as far as mp3-files are concerned.)

In the properties of MinimServer I have included "Initialkey" in the indexTags list. That works fine for flac-Files, but not for mp3s.

Everything else I have tried did not work either (esp. not Tkey, or Key), and I did not find any other hints on how to access tkey-field. On the contrary the list of tag mappings (https://minimserver.com/ug-library.html#Tag%20mappings) does not include TKEY.

Could you add TKEY or tell me how to access it? (I know, I could invent some new tag name for both mp3[TXXX:...] and flac and use that, but I would rather stick to the common way of tagging key.) - THX!

RE: Tag: TKEY (InitialKey)
MinimServer is not currently reading or mapping the TKEY tag, so to make this work you would need a TXXX tag such as TXXX:INITIALKEY. I will look into adding a mapping for TKEY in a future version of MinimServer.

RE: Tag: TKEY (InitialKey)
The recommended way to rescan without using the cache is to change the startupScan property to full and then do the rescan. After this, you should set startupScan back to the default setting of true.
